About the position

Amazon Web Services Infrastructure Services is seeking a Senior Electrical Engineer to join our global engineering team. This role is critical as AWS Infrastructure Services is responsible for the design, planning, delivery, and operation of all AWS global infrastructure, ensuring that our cloud services remain operational and efficient. As part of this team, you will work on the most challenging problems in the industry, dealing with thousands of variables that impact the supply chain. We are looking for talented individuals who are eager to contribute to our mission of providing the highest standards for safety and security while delivering exceptional capacity at the lowest possible cost for our customers. In this position, you will leverage your hands-on electrical design experience to create resilient and cost-effective electrical distribution systems. You will be responsible for taking designs from concept through to the permit and construction document set, defining critical equipment specifications, and approving equipment submittals. Your role will involve direct support for construction, participating in the process from site selection review through commissioning and turnover. Responsibilities

  • Data center electrical designs and collaboration with other disciplines to create a construction document set.
  • Creation of designs which meet or exceed quality requirements and fall within budgetary constraints.
  • Work with local agencies having jurisdiction to ensure compliance with federal, state, and municipal requirements and building codes.
  • Review and approval of equipment submittals.
  • Define project scope and provide technical support for information requests prior to and during construction phases.
  • Work with commissioning teams to properly test and validate installation, operation, and performance of electrical systems.
  • Ability to work on concurrent projects in multiple geographical regions.
  • Travel to sites for site review and work with onsite field engineers, as well as provide engineering evaluations, electrical systems audits, and startup as needed.
  • Offer creative, out-of-the-box solutions.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in electrical engineering or 12+ years of relevant electrical experience.
  • 7+ years of experience with industrial or commercial electrical design.
  • 9+ years of experience developing design documentation (plans, specifications, etc.) for construction and/or permitting.

Nice-to-haves

  • Professional Engineering License and knowledge of building codes and regulations including Life Safety, IBC, NFPA, NEC, and OSHA.
  • Ability to research new designs, technologies, and construction methods of data center equipment and facilities.
  • An ability and willingness to think outside of the box to find creative and innovative solutions to reduce costs without impacting quality, reliability, or maintainability.
  • Detailed understanding of uninterruptible power sources, diesel generators, electrical switchgear, power distribution units, variable frequency drives, and automatic/static transfer switches.
  • Experience with fast track design/build projects, multiple significant upgrade projects, large scale technical operations, or large-scale compute farms.
